The Gangetic crocodile, also known as the Gharial, is a unique and fascinating species native to the rivers of India and Nepal. With its long, slender snout filled with sharp teeth, this crocodilian is perfectly adapted for catching fish in fast-flowing waters. Unfortunately, due to habitat loss and hunting, the population of Gangetic crocodiles has drastically declined in recent years. Conservation efforts are underway to protect these incredible creatures and ensure their survival for future generations. With their distinctive appearance and important role in maintaining healthy river ecosystems they can truly a symbol of the rich biodiversity found in South Asia.
